How they compare
Malta currently reports 2.7% against 1.2% in Romania, a difference of 1.5%.
That makes Malta's figure about 2.3 times Romania's.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 7 shared years of data; in 2014 it was Malta ahead.
Malta ranks 43rd and Romania ranks 44th of 44 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Malta averaged higher in 1 and Romania in 1.
